AC Horsens
Anton Skipper moved to AC Horsens, where he began to establish himself more prominently in senior football. According to Transfermarkt, he joined AC Horsens in July 2019 from FC Nordsjælland and remained with the club until August 2021, when he transferred to Sarpsborg 08 FF [Transfermarkt]. Sarpsborg 08 FF
In August 2021, Skipper made a move to Norwegian club Sarpsborg 08 FF, marking a significant step in his career by joining a club in a different European league. His transfer to Sarpsborg 08 FF from AC Horsens was confirmed by Transfermarkt [Transfermarkt]. This move offered him the opportunity to compete in the Eliteserien, Norway's top flight, further broadening his experience and exposing him to different styles of play.
